New Birth Brass Band

New Birth Family

2005-01-31

The New Birth Brass Band was formed in the mid 80’s in the 6th Ward New Orleans living room of Mrs. Elaine Terry, mother of New Birth trumpeter Kenny Terry.

The band’s line-up has changed greatly over the years and this album is a reunion of sorts, bringing many past members back into the fold.

The CD was recorded live at the Truck Farm Studio in New Orleans and many of the songs were captured in just one take. It’s more great brass band music to get you into the Mardi Gras Spirit.
